pv988.h

来自「用vb实现在线考试系统」· C头文件 代码 · 共 50 行

H
50
字号

#ifndef _BT848DLL_H_
#define _BT848DLL_H_

#include "Btenum.h"

#ifdef __cplusplus
extern "C" {
#endif

__declspec(dllexport) BOOL __stdcall MV_GetTotalCard(WORD* lpTotalCard); //CARD
__declspec(dllexport) void __stdcall MV_SetCurrentCard(WORD wHWCardNo); 
__declspec(dllexport) WORD __stdcall MV_GetCurrentCard(); 

__declspec(dllexport) void __stdcall MV_CreateHWDrv(HWND pWnd,WORD wHWCardNo,WORD  wHWPortNo);
__declspec(dllexport) void __stdcall MV_StartHWDrv(HWND pWnd);
__declspec(dllexport) void __stdcall MV_SuspendHWDrv();
__declspec(dllexport) void __stdcall MV_KillHWDrv() ;

__declspec(dllexport) void __stdcall MV_SetVideoShift(BYTE vids , short wShift );
__declspec(dllexport) void __stdcall MV_SetVideoRect(RECT *lpRect) ;
__declspec(dllexport) void __stdcall MV_GetVideoRect(RECT *lpRect) ;
__declspec(dllexport) void __stdcall MV_SetVideoPos(RECT *lpRect);

__declspec(dllexport) void __stdcall MV_SetVideoStandard(BYTE iTVStandard );
__declspec(dllexport) void __stdcall MV_SetVideoSource(BYTE PortNum );
__declspec(dllexport) void __stdcall MV_SetVideoColor( BYTE iColorIndex ,WORD iColorValue );
__declspec(dllexport) void __stdcall MV_SetColorFormat( BYTE iColorFormat,BOOL AutoFlag );

__declspec(dllexport) void __stdcall MV_IsMultiPort(BOOL bMultiPort);
__declspec(dllexport) BYTE __stdcall MV_GetCurrentPort(); //PORT#
__declspec(dllexport) BYTE __stdcall MV_GetTotalPort();
__declspec(dllexport) double __stdcall MV_GetWidthScale() ;
__declspec(dllexport) BYTE __stdcall MV_GetColorFormat();
__declspec(dllexport) BYTE __stdcall MV_GetVideoStandard();
__declspec(dllexport) DWORD __stdcall MV_GetVideoRate() ;
__declspec(dllexport) void __stdcall MV_SetVideoRate(BYTE VRate) ;

__declspec(dllexport) BYTE *  __stdcall MV_GetVImgPtr()  ;
__declspec(dllexport) BITMAPINFO* __stdcall MV_GetVImgDIBHd();
  
#ifdef __cplusplus
}
#endif
 

#endif /*_BT848DLL_H_*/

 

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?